oh-my-good-glorious-mother-of-wonder! we had the most awesome opportunity to photograph this wedding in the most breathtaking place, salt lake city, utah. we shot n’tima & steven’s heartfelt wedding with old film cameras as well as captured their day on video. this duo is very much loved & know gobs of talented artists, there were not only quite a few family documenters but alsothe greens shot digital stills of the day. we had such a charming time with visiting guests attending from all over the world.

n’tima was quite the diy bride, oh my gosh, her amazingly lovely dress was from thrift store which her grandma made alterations to. swoon. she dyed her own shoes on the hotel stove-top the night before the wedding steven was sporting his favorite black toms & aztec print tie. her grandpa served as the master of the ceremonies & her grandma as her beautiful matron of honor. :)
n’tima & steven have so much love for one another. just such a humble, pure & genuine relationship that survived across the sea. they just give off those warm vibes that make your heart sing & dance! these two have the most amazing love story & wrote in journals to each other with 6,229 miles between them for 642 days & 17 hours separating them there love survived, & we are so super happy for them that they are finally man & wife! yay!!!! :) :)
